This month co-hosts Neil Kalin and Michael Simkin will once again discuss the most important and pertinent cases affecting real estate in California.  As usual, attendees will earn one hour of self-study MCLE for free.*  Plus, every attendee has a chance to win a gift card for one hour of MCLE credit from the pre-recorded RPLS library.    

This month’s cases cover the following issues:

  1.  Whether a terminated property manager is entitled to tenant protections;
  2.  Whether payment after expiration of a fixed term lease automatically creates a new tenancy; 
  3. Burden of proof to establish a prescriptive easement;  
  4. Whether rent rules can be created by initiative and whether granting addition time to pay rent conflicts with State law; and…
  5. Sidewalk vendor rights and remedies.
